Huawei Bags Deal from Bharti Airtel for Network Expansion in Africa
July 08, 2011

Huawei and Bharti Airtel have signed an agreement for network infrastructure update and expansion in Africa for US$400 million, according to a July 8, 2011 report by the Shenzhen Post. As per the agreement, Huawei will design, plan, modernize, and expand Bharti Airtel's network. It is projected that Huawei will also be in charge of facility management and maintenance. It is reported that Huawei will deploy complete GSM (Global System for Mobile Communications) and 3G product portfolio for Bharti Airtel.
